Job Description

We are seeking a highly motivated and detail-oriented Research Assistant to join our team at the forefront of iPSC biobanking and automation. The successful candidate will play a pivotal role not only in establishing automation workflow but also in the collection, characterization, and maintenance of induced pluripotent stem cell lines, contributing directly to cutting-edge research initiatives in regenerative medicine, disease modeling, and drug discovery.

 

Responsibilities:

1. Automation specialist

   - Develop, optimize and troubleshoot automated liquid handling protocols on the Opentrons platform.

   - Designated person in charge of matters for the Opentrons system (assist with creating protocols if required for users interested in using the Opentrons for experiments)

2. iPSC Culture and Maintenance:

   - Execute established protocols for the culture and expansion of iPSC lines.

   - Monitor cell growth, viability, and quality control parameters.

   - Perform routine passaging and cryopreservation of iPSCs.

   - Maintain accurate records of cell culture activities.

3. iPSC Characterization:

- Conduct immunocytochemistry, flow cytometry, and molecular biology techniques to assess pluripotency and differentiation potential of iPSC lines.

   - Perform karyotyping and other cytogenetic analyses to ensure genomic stability.

   - Collaborate with researchers to design and implement experiments for iPSC characterization.

4. Biobanking Operations:

   - Coordinate sample collection, processing, and storage according to standardized protocols.

   - Label, track, and catalog iPSC samples in the biobank database.

   - Implement quality control measures to ensure sample integrity and compliance with regulatory

     requirements.

   - Assist in the development and optimization of biobanking workflows.

5. Data Management and Analysis:

   - Compile and organize experimental data, including cell culture records, characterization results, and

     biobank inventory information.

   - Analyze data using statistical methods and assist in the preparation of research reports and

     presentations.

   - Contribute to the maintenance and updating of laboratory databases and electronic notebooks.

6. Laboratory Support:

   - Maintain cleanliness and orderliness of the laboratory.

   - Assist in the procurement and organization of laboratory supplies and reagents.

   - Support other members of the research team in experimental procedures and technical troubleshooting.
